Yemen's Ambassador the Republic of Cuba Mohammad Nasher met on Saturday with Director of Middle East and Northern Africa Department at Cuban Ministry of Foreign Affairs Roberto Dominguez.
The two officials discussed different common issues, mainly the unique and strong relations between the two countries and means of boosting them.
Ambassador Nasher briefed Cuban official on the latest developments in Yemen and position of the legitimate government on realizing peace on the bases of the three international supported references; the GCC Initiative, the outcomes of the National Dialogue Conference and the UN Resolution 2216.
He confirmed that the government of President Abdo Rabbu Mansour Hadi continues work with all international community organizations to realize just and inclusive peace in Yemen.
He noted that the Houthi-Saleh's militias have been continuing their war on the Yemeni people, violating human rights and hindering peace efforts supported by the international community.
For his part, Domínguez confirmed keenness of his country's government in Yemen's conditions and renewed his country's support to the government of Yemen to stop the war and realize peace.
He also confirmed his country's firmed attitude to Yemen and Arab Group on supporting Geneva recent conference on Human Rights.
